I think the real problem is that the image appears to be a gif file. Now although gifs have transparency, their bitrate is too low for SU. They are only only indexed 256 color instead of full 24bit RGB like jpg files or the 32 bit RGBA png files.
You'll need to raise the image's bitrate in some image editor that allows a change of mode, then save it as a png with transparency.
